Transaction 530663076faa64bb6e1f0f3d7b8256677f745e4c9e75369f607e17c224579bf3

block
af21b44e0d23a8d8c624104cedf7b51a3becb5dcfc21442a138bd58a83e77d07

1 Input

2 Outputs